当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储是啥,对象存储目录,数据管理新时代的核心枢纽

对象存储是啥,对象存储目录,数据管理新时代的核心枢纽

对象存储是面向非结构化数据设计的分布式存储架构,支持海量对象的高效存储与访问,具有高可用性、弹性扩展和低成本特性,其核心通过分层存储策略和智能缓存机制,实现冷热数据动态...

对象存储是面向非结构化数据设计的分布式存储架构,支持海量对象的高效存储与访问,具有高可用性、弹性扩展和低成本特性,其核心通过分层存储策略和智能缓存机制,实现冷热数据动态管理,满足PB级数据存储需求,对象存储目录作为数据组织的核心枢纽,采用树状层级结构,支持多级命名空间划分与细粒度权限控制,结合智能标签和元数据管理,可精准定位分布在分布式节点上的数据资源,在数据管理新时代,对象存储目录通过AI驱动的自动化运维、多模态数据融合和跨云协同能力,成为企业数据湖、数字孪生等新范式的基础设施支撑,同时满足合规审计、实时检索和智能分析等复合需求,重构了从数据存取到价值挖掘的全生命周期管理体系。

(全文约3280字)

对象存储技术演进与目录体系重构 1.1 存储技术的三次革命性突破 (1)块存储时代(1950-2000):以IBM 350大型机为代表的物理存储设备,采用树状索引结构管理数据块 (2)文件存储革命(2000-2010):NTFS/XFS等文件系统引入目录层级,实现TB级数据管理 (3)对象存储崛起(2010至今):EC2 S3等云存储服务突破传统容量限制,对象ID直接映射数据单元

2 对象存储的三大核心特征 (1)唯一性标识:全球唯一的对象键(Object Key)采用复合哈希算法生成 (2)分布式架构:基于Raft/Paxos协议的节点自愈机制 (3)版本控制:多版本对象存储(如S3的版本回溯功能)

3 目录体系在对象存储中的角色演变 (1)从物理目录到逻辑目录:从设备级管理转向数据服务层抽象 (2)访问控制中枢:CORS、IAM策略的执行入口 (3)元数据仓库:存储对象生命周期全息信息

对象存储目录的核心功能架构 2.1 四维元数据管理体系 (1)静态元数据:对象键、创建时间、内容类型(MIME类型) (2)动态元数据:访问计数、存储类标记、自定义标签(Key-Value对) (3)安全元数据:访问策略(JSON格式策略文件)、加密算法(AES-256) (4)位置元数据:热/温/冷数据分布记录、跨区域复制状态

对象存储是啥,对象存储目录,数据管理新时代的核心枢纽

图片来源于网络,如有侵权联系删除

2 多级目录嵌套结构 (1)单层目录模型:适用于简单场景(如媒体库) (2)层级目录结构:模拟传统文件系统(/home/user/docs) (3)虚拟目录系统:通过API动态生成目录(如AWS S3 prefixes) (4)多级标签体系:复合查询条件(tags:environment=prod AND region=us-east)

3 智能目录服务特性 (1)自动分类(Auto-classification):基于NLP的内容标签自动生成 (2)智能路由:根据存储成本自动选择对象存储位置 (3)生命周期智能管理:自动迁移/归档/删除策略引擎 (4)跨云目录整合:多云存储统一目录视图(如MinIO的Multi-Cloud功能)

技术实现原理与架构设计 3.1 分布式目录数据库选型 (1)键值存储方案:Redis/S Boluses(适用于小规模元数据) (2)文档数据库:MongoDB/Couchbase(支持复杂查询) (3)图数据库:Neo4j(用于复杂关联关系管理)

2 元数据存储架构对比 (1)分层存储架构:

  • L1:内存缓存(Redis Cluster)
  • L2:SSD缓存(Alluxio)
  • L3:HDD归档(Ceph对象存储)

(2)分布式一致性保障:

  • 3副本写入(S3的跨区域复制)
  • CRDT合并算法(用于异步更新)
  • 哈希环动态调整(节点扩容时自动迁移)

3 访问控制执行引擎 (1)策略语法解析:

  • AWS IAM JSON策略语法
  • Azure RBAC的Bicep模板
  • Open Policy Agent的rego表达式

(2)决策执行流程:

  • 策略加载(YAML/JSON)
  • 上下文构建(IP/用户/对象键)
  • 策略匹配(正则表达式引擎)
  • 决策响应(允许/拒绝/审计)

与传统文件存储的对比分析 4.1 数据模型差异对比 (1)对象存储:键值对(Key-Value)存储 (2)文件存储:树状目录+文件名+扩展名 (3)数据库存储:关系型表结构

2 访问性能测试数据 (1)对象存储随机访问延迟:50-200ms(S3标准型) (2)文件存储目录遍历延迟:1-5ms(ext4文件系统) (3)对象存储批量访问效率:5000+对象/秒(吞吐量测试)

3 管理复杂度对比 (1)对象存储目录管理:

  • 单对象权限管理
  • 版本控制
  • 策略动态更新

(2)文件存储目录管理:

  • 大小限制(4GB文件限制)
  • 硬链接/软链接
  • ACL继承机制

典型应用场景与实施策略 5.1 云原生应用架构 (1)CI/CD流水线存储:

  • Git仓库对象目录
  • 构建包版本管理
  • 环境配置文件存储

(2)监控数据存储:

  • 日志聚合目录
  • 系统指标存储
  • 可视化查询目录

2 企业级数据治理 (1)合规性目录:

  • GDPR数据保留目录
  • CCPA访问记录
  • 等保三级审计目录

(2)数据安全目录:

  • 密钥管理目录(KMS)
  • 加密对象索引
  • 审计日志存储

3 新兴技术融合场景 (1)AI训练数据管理:

  • 标注数据目录
  • 模型版本目录
  • 训练日志目录

(2)物联网数据存储:

  • 设备注册目录
  • 传感器数据流目录
  • 异常事件目录

性能优化与故障处理 6.1 高吞吐量优化策略 (1)批量操作(Batch Operations):

  • 对象批量上传(1000+对象/次)
  • 批量删除(Delete Multiple)
  • 批量复制(Copy Objects)

(2)对象键优化:

  • 哈希前缀(Hashed Prefix)
  • 时间戳前缀(Time-based Prefix)
  • 自定义前缀(Custom Prefix)

2 故障恢复机制 (1)数据恢复流程:

  • 从最近快照恢复(Point-in-Time Recovery)
  • 交叉区域复制(Cross-Region Replication)
  • 多区域冗余存储(Multi-Region Redundancy)

(2)目录恢复策略:

  • 元数据快照(Metadata Snapshot)
  • 副本目录同步(Replica Sync)
  • 手动目录重建(Manual Directory Rebuild)

3 安全加固方案 (1)零信任架构实施:

对象存储是啥,对象存储目录,数据管理新时代的核心枢纽

图片来源于网络,如有侵权联系删除

  • 持续身份验证(MFA)
  • 动态权限调整(Just-in-Time)
  • 审计追踪(Audit Trail)

(2)加密增强措施:

  • 路径加密(Object Key + metadata)
  • 密钥轮换(Key Rotation)
  • 加密密钥管理(KMS CMK)

未来发展趋势与挑战 7.1 技术演进路线图 (1)2024-2026:多模态目录融合(文件/对象/数据库统一目录) (2)2027-2029:量子加密目录(抗量子计算加密算法) (3)2030+:神经形态目录(类脑存储架构)

2 行业挑战与应对 (1)数据主权问题:

  • GDPR合规目录
  • 区域化存储目录
  • 数据本地化存储

(2)能耗优化挑战:

  • 冷数据目录优化
  • 存储虚拟化技术
  • 绿色存储目录

(3)AI融合挑战:

  • 智能目录训练
  • 对象键生成模型
  • 目录自优化算法

3 标准化进程 (1)API标准化:

  • RESTful API 3.0
  • gRPC对象存储协议
  • GraphQL目录查询

(2)互操作能力:

  • 多云目录互通
  • 开源目录中间件
  • 容器目录集成

实施指南与最佳实践 8.1 实施步骤: (1)需求分析阶段(目录结构设计) (2)架构设计阶段(分布式方案选择) (3)开发实施阶段(API对接) (4)测试验证阶段(压力测试) (5)运维监控阶段(目录健康检查)

2 评估指标: (1)性能指标:

  • 响应延迟(P99 < 200ms)
  • 吞吐量(>5000对象/秒)
  • 请求成功率(>99.99%)

(2)安全指标:

  • 密钥轮换周期(<30天)
  • 审计日志保留(>180天)
  • 零信任合规率(100%)

(3)成本指标:

  • 存储成本($0.023/GB/月)
  • 访问成本($0.0004/千次请求)
  • 运维成本(<15%总成本)

3 典型错误规避: (1)目录结构设计误区:

  • 过度嵌套(>6级)
  • 缺乏版本控制
  • 未做索引优化

(2)权限配置错误:

  • 过度开放策略(Deny列表缺失)
  • 未及时更新策略
  • 多账户权限混淆

(3)性能调优失误:

  • 未启用批量操作
  • 缺乏缓存机制
  • 未做预热加载

典型案例分析 9.1 某电商平台对象存储目录设计 (1)目录结构: /product ├── 2023 │ ├── 10月 │ │ ├── sales │ │ └── inventory │ └── 11月 └── user ├── profile └── behavior

(2)技术选型:

  • 元数据存储:Ceph对象存储
  • 访问控制:AWS IAM + OpenPolicyAgent
  • 安全加密:AWS KMS + AES-256-GCM

2 智能制造日志存储方案 (1)目录设计: /fty ├── 2023Q4 │ ├── machine-001 │ │ ├── logs │ │ ├── metrics │ │ └── alerts │ └── machine-002 └── quality ├── reports └── audits

(2)实现特点:

  • 时间序列索引(InfluxDB集成)
  • 实时告警目录(Prometheus Alertmanager)
  • 自动压缩目录(ZSTD算法)

总结与展望 对象存储目录作为数据管理的核心枢纽,正在经历从传统存储目录的继承到智能化演进的关键转型,随着多模态数据融合、量子加密技术、神经形态存储等新技术的突破,目录体系将实现从"存储容器"到"数据神经中枢"的质变,未来的对象存储目录不仅需要处理PB级数据,还要具备自我进化能力,通过机器学习预测存储需求,利用区块链确保数据可信,最终构建起安全、高效、智能的下一代数据管理平台。

(全文完)

注:本文通过构建完整的技术体系解析框架,结合最新行业实践数据(截至2023Q3),采用原创性架构设计案例,全面覆盖对象存储目录从理论到实践的完整知识图谱,文中技术参数均来自权威厂商白皮书及第三方测试报告,核心观点经过多轮技术验证,确保内容的专业性和准确性。

黑狐家游戏

发表评论

最新文章